The Critical Role of Plumbing in Bathroom Renovation

A successful bathroom renovation hinges on reliable plumbing:

  • Proper Drainage & Ventilation: Ensures water flows smoothly and prevents moisture buildup that leads to mold.
  • Fixture Installation: From rain showers to dual-sink vanities, accurate installation prevents leaks and ensures optimal performance.
  • Waterproofing: Integral to protecting walls and subfloors; professional plumbers coordinate with contractors to seal every joint.

Skipping or skimping on plumbing expertise can lead to costly repairs and potential damage—so it pays to get it right the first time.

Choosing the Right Contractor in Toronto

Selecting a trusted general contractor Toronto homeowners rave about isn’t always straightforward. Keep these tips in mind:

  1. Verify Credentials
    Look for a contractor who is fully licensed, insured, and bonded in Ontario. This safeguards you against liability and ensures compliance with local building codes.
  2. Portfolio & Case Studies
    A strong track record of completed bathroom renovation projects demonstrates both design sensibility and technical skill. Ask for before-and-after photos and client testimonials.
  3. Transparent Pricing
    The best contractors provide clear, itemized estimates that cover labor, materials, permits, and any subcontracted plumbing work.
  4. Communication & Timelines
    Renovations can be disruptive. A reliable professional outlines a realistic schedule and keeps you informed of any changes or unexpected challenges.

Steps to Your Dream Bathroom in Toronto

  1. Initial Consultation
    Discuss your style preferences, budget, and timeline. Your contractor will assess the space, identify any structural or plumbing challenges, and propose solutions.
  2. Design & Planning
    Finalize layout changes (e.g., moving toilettes or enlarging showers). Choose fixtures, tiles, lighting, and finishes that reflect current trends while withstanding daily use.
  3. Permitting & Prep Work
    The contractor secures necessary permits and demolition begins. Any outdated plumbing lines are replaced to accommodate new fixtures.
  4. Rough-In Plumbing & Framing
    Plumbers install supply and drain lines; carpenters adjust framing for new tubs or custom cabinetry.
  5. Inspections & Drywall
    Municipal inspections ensure code compliance. Once approved, walls are closed up and moisture-resistant drywall is installed.
  6. Finishes & Final Fixtures
    Tiles go up, faucets are mounted, mirrors hung, and lighting tested. Final inspections confirm everything functions as expected.
  7. Walk-Through & Warranty
    You and the contractor review the finished space, addressing any minor touch-ups. Reputable contractors stand behind their work with warranties on both labor and materials.
